Некорректное расположение блоков после переноса

Главные вкладки

Аватар пользователя crroda crroda 28 сентября 2018 в 10:23

Доброго времени суток!

Возникла проблема при переносе сайта.

Сделал бэкап сайта, базы данных, приватных папок.

Развернул на сервере, блоки съехали. Удалял htacess. в папках private,tmp,storage, проблема осталась. Чистил кэш, не помогает.

Блоки определял по новой, безрезультатно.

Будут ли какие советы? Буду очень признателен.

ps. Проошу прощения если тема заезженная, для меня она нова.

Обновлял с 7.50 до 7.59

Комментарии

Аватар пользователя ivnish ivnish 28 сентября 2018 в 10:32

Смею предположить, что у вас внесены изменения либо в контрибную тему оформления, либо в тему ядра. При обновлении эти изменения слетают. Смотрите CSS стили, почему блоки убегают

ЗЫ. Ужасный блочный дизайн. Очень тяжело следить за обновлениями в блоках.

Аватар пользователя crroda crroda 28 сентября 2018 в 10:41

Смею предположить, что у вас внесены изменения либо в контрибную тему оформления, либо в тему ядра. При обновлении эти изменения слетают. Смотрите CSS стили, почему блоки убегают

Проблема в том, что и без обновления блоки слетают (・・ ) ?

т.е., разварачиваю на новом сервере и все, блоки как не родные.

Аватар пользователя Semantics Semantics 28 сентября 2018 в 10:55

Допускаю, что при вёрстке стили вписывали не в исходные файлы, а в агрегированные.
Соответственно, сброс кеша, перестрой агрегатов и привет

Аватар пользователя crroda crroda 28 сентября 2018 в 11:07

Semantics wrote:
стили вписывали не в исходные файлы, а в агрегированные

Вот тут по подробнее, пожалуйста...

Аватар пользователя ivnish ivnish 28 сентября 2018 в 11:13

Вот тут /admin/config/development/performance можно включить сжатие js и css. После чего в каталоге /files/css появятся агрегированные стили. Semantics предполагает, что вы вписывали изменения в них, а не в исходные стили аля style.css

Аватар пользователя ivnish ivnish 28 сентября 2018 в 11:15

Если блоки "убегают" без обновления, то вам поможет только сравнение стилей в инспекторе браузера на исходном сервере и на новом. Либо на локалке и на новом, если на локалке всё нормально.

Какая версия PHP была на старом сервере, а какая на новом?

Аватар пользователя crroda crroda 28 сентября 2018 в 11:17

itcrowd72 wrote:

Semantics предполагает, что вы вписывали изменения в них

А если же я не делал каких либо изменении вообще?

т.е. развернул бэкапы и блоки уже сбиты.

Аватар пользователя sas@drupal.org sas@drupal.org 28 сентября 2018 в 11:24

Смотреть, проверять настройку по файловой системе - возможно не может собрать css js + смотреть сообщение в консоли браузера F12.

Аватар пользователя xakd xakd 28 сентября 2018 в 11:29

И да, не надо одновременно "крутить две ручки радиоприемника". Сначала обновите на основном, а потом уже гарантированно переносите.

Аватар пользователя crroda crroda 28 сентября 2018 в 11:34

itcrowd72 wrote:

сравнение стилей в инспекторе браузера на исходном сервере и на новом

Стили сравнил, идентичны, без каких либо изменений.

На исходном:

PHP 5.4.45-1~dotdeb+7.1

На новом:

PHP 5.6.38-0+deb8u1

Аватар пользователя ivnish ivnish 28 сентября 2018 в 12:10

Разверните сайт на локалке с таким же окружением, как и на новом сервере (OpenServer, виртуалка, докер, не важно) и посмотрите на локалке